## Indications for Use

The OPUS CK-MB & Total CK Controls are intended for use as quality control material to monitor the precision and accuracy of the OPUS CK-MB and Total CK assay.

## Device Story

OPUS CK-MB & Total CK Controls are bovine calf serum-based, tri-level (low, mid, high) quality control materials; contain human CK-MB and rabbit skeletal CK. Used in clinical laboratories to monitor precision/accuracy of OPUS Immunoassay System assays. Provided as lyophilized product; stored at +2° to +8°C. Healthcare providers use control results to verify assay performance and ensure reliable patient testing.

## Clinical Evidence

Bench testing only. Precision evaluated on OPUS Immunoassay System. Intra-assay precision (n=20): %CV 7.5-10.7% (CK-MB), 6.8-7.1% (Total CK). Inter-assay precision (n=20): %CV 7.2-9.3% (CK-MB), 5.9-6.6% (Total CK).

## Regulatory Identification

A quality control material (assayed and unassayed) for clinical chemistry is a device intended for medical purposes for use in a test system to estimate test precision and to detect systematic analytical deviations that may arise from reagent or analytical instrument variation. A quality control material (assayed and unassayed) may be used for proficiency testing in interlaboratory surveys. This generic type of device includes controls (assayed and unassayed) for blood gases, electrolytes, enzymes, multianalytes (all kinds), single (specified) analytes, or urinalysis controls.

## 5. Medical device to which equivalence is claimed and comparison information:

The OPUS CK-MB &amp; Total CK Controls are substantially equivalent in intended use to the BIORAD Liquichek™ CK-MB Controls. Both products are *in vitro* diagnostic reagents intended for use as a quality control material to monitor specific laboratory procedures. The OPUS CK-MB &amp; Total CK Controls like the Liquichek™ CK-MB Controls are a tri-level serum-based matrix controls for specific cardiac assays. Both controls are provided with lot specific values. The OPUS CK-MB &amp; Total CK Controls and the Liquichek™ CK-MB Controls both contain two analytes. Both the OPUS CK-MB &amp; Total CK Controls and the Liquichek™ CK-MB Controls are provided with known values for Behring OPUS Immunoassay System.

The Behring Diagnostics’ OPUS CK-MB &amp; Total CK Controls differ from the BIORAD Liquichek™ CK-MB Controls in that the OPUS CK-MB &amp; Total CK Controls can be stored at +2° to +8°C, while the BIORAD controls must be stored at -10° to -20°C. Also the OPUS CK-MB &amp; Total CK Control is provided as lyophilized control while the Liquichek™ CK-MB Controls are provided in liquid form.

## 6. Proposed Device Performance Characteristics:

Precision of the OPUS CK-MB &amp; Total CK Controls was evaluated on an OPUS Immunoassay System with the OPUS CK-MB and Total CK assays. Intra assay precision was evaluated by running an n=20 with each level of the OPUS controls. %CV’s ranged from 7.5% to 10.7% for CK-MB and 6.8% to 7.1% for Total CK.

The inter assay precision was evaluated by running duplicate determinations for each level of control twice per day (AM and PM) for five days to total an n=20. %CV’s ranged from 7.2% to 9.3% for CK-MB and 5.9% and 6.6% for Total CK.
